Termination for Relief. Notwithstanding any other provision of this Agreement, a party shall be entitled to terminate this Agreement and the Services, with immediate effect by providing written notice to the other party, if performance of the respective undertakings is delayed more than sixty (60) days by reason of any grounds for relief as described in this Article.
